Forest Stewardship Classes

2012 Forest Stewardship Class Series – passed

Wednesdays, October 3 through November 28, 2012, from 6 to 9 p.m. at the Land Trust Building. Offered by King County and Washington State University Extension, and sponsored by the Vashon-Maury Island Land Trust and the Vashon Forest Stewards.

Discover the many ways you can meet your personal ownership goals with our training and technical assistance for forest landowners and those who live in or near forests. This flagship 10-session course teaches forest landowners how to prepare their own forest stewardship plan with guidance from natural resource professionals who will show how to keep your forestlands healthy and productive, and attract more wildlife. By the end of the class, you will have completed a forest stewardship plan for your property, which can qualify you for property tax reductions and cost share assistance.
